深入解析VPN配置文件的结构与安全配置要点

hk258369 2026-01-27 vpn下载 6 0

在当今数字化办公和远程协作日益普及的背景下,虚拟私人网络(VPN)已成为企业和个人用户保障数据传输安全的核心工具,而一个高效、安全的VPN服务,离不开精心设计和正确配置的VPN配置文件,作为网络工程师,理解并掌握VPN配置文件的结构与配置要点,是部署稳定、可靠网络连接的关键一步。

什么是VPN配置文件?简而言之,它是一个包含建立VPN连接所需参数的文本或二进制文件,通常由客户端软件读取后自动完成身份验证、加密协商和隧道建立过程,常见的配置格式包括OpenVPN的.ovpn文件、WireGuard的.conf文件以及Windows内置的.pcf.xml格式,不同协议的配置文件结构略有差异,但核心要素高度一致:认证信息、服务器地址、加密算法、路由规则等。

以OpenVPN为例,其配置文件通常包含以下关键部分:

  1. 基本连接信息:如remote server.example.com 1194指定服务器IP和端口;
  2. 证书与密钥路径:使用ca ca.crtcert client.crtkey client.key加载公钥基础设施(PKI)组件;
  3. 加密与认证设置:例如cipher AES-256-CBC定义对称加密算法,auth SHA256选择哈希算法;
  4. 协议与端口:通过proto udpproto tcp指定传输层协议,UDP常用于低延迟场景;
  5. 路由控制redirect-gateway def1可将所有流量重定向至VPN隧道,实现全网加密;
  6. 日志与调试选项:如verb 3控制日志详细程度,便于排错。

配置文件的安全性至关重要,若配置不当,可能导致敏感信息泄露或被中间人攻击,常见风险包括:

  • 明文存储密码或私钥(应使用强密码保护或集成证书机制);
  • 使用弱加密算法(如DES或MD5);
  • 缺乏客户端身份验证(应启用双向TLS认证);
  • 配置中硬编码了敏感凭据(建议使用环境变量或外部密钥管理服务)。

企业级部署还应考虑配置文件的集中管理与分发,利用Ansible或Puppet自动化部署统一模板,结合LDAP/AD进行用户权限绑定,确保每个员工获得个性化且合规的配置,对于移动办公场景,可通过MDM(移动设备管理)平台推送加密后的配置文件到iOS或Android设备,避免手动配置错误。

配置文件的版本控制同样不可忽视,建议将其纳入Git等版本控制系统,记录每次变更,便于回滚和审计,定期审查配置内容是否符合最新的安全标准(如NIST SP 800-53或ISO 27001),并测试连接稳定性与性能表现。

一个高质量的VPN配置文件不仅是技术实现的基础,更是网络安全的第一道防线,作为网络工程师,必须从结构清晰、安全严谨、运维便捷三个维度优化配置文件,才能真正构建值得信赖的远程访问体系。

深入解析VPN配置文件的结构与安全配置要点